Common DecoStudio.EXE Errors on Windows
Encountering errors associated with DecoStudio.EXE can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to DecoStudio.EXE,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.
- DecoStudio.EXE Application Error: This warning appears when the executable application faces a difficulty during its operation. This could be brought about by software errors, damaged associated files, or clashes with other running programs.
- Error 0xc0000142: This alert pops up when an application fails to initiate properly. This could be the result of software glitches, damaged files, or complications with the Windows registry.
- Access is Denied: This alert emerges when the system prohibits access to a requested file or resource. This could be because of inadequate user rights, conflicts in file ownership, or stringent file permissions.
-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.
- DecoStudio.EXE - Bad Image Error:: This error arises when Windows cannot run DecoStudio.EXE due to the file being corrupted, or because the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
